There's a lot of buzz about "Zero Clients" nowadays. It is often claimed that they have "no operating system" and "no CPU". This is a myth. No computer can run without a CPU, and there must be at least some minimal system software. (...)
That's quite right, with at least one exception. There are (were) zero clients from Pano Logic, which are based on a FPGA architecture. See a white paper, published by IGEL - "Zero Clients – Is There Really Anything There?" (can be easily found on the Internet)
